* bsps/stm32h7: add configuration and enable build of stm32h757i-eval-m4 BSPKarel Gardas2022-06-0111-3/+66
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| This is minimalist configuration for the stm32h757i-eval-m4 BSP provided here. The only general enhancement worth mention is a flash origin address configuration which is needed for simplification as M4 core boots from second flash bank which starts at 0x8100000 by default. The boot address of the core may be changed by using STM32CubeProgrammer. If done so then also BSP configuration needs to be changed accordingly. As the BSP variant is running on M4 core, there is also more configuration changes required here. E.g. boot core and ABI (compilation flags) in comparison with stm32h757i-eval BSP. On the other hand, C code is shared completely with this BSP variant. Sponsored-By: Precidata

* bsps: Add <dev/irq/arm-gicv3.h>Sebastian Huber2022-04-062-0/+2
| | | | | | | | Separate the Interrupt Manager implementation from the generic Arm GICv3 support. Move parts of the Arm GICv3 support into a new header file. This helps to support systems with a clustered structure in which multiple GICv3 instances are present. For example, two clusters of two Cortex-R52 cores where each cluster has a dedicated GICv3 instance.

* smp: Add fatal errorSebastian Huber2022-03-242-0/+23
| | | | | | | Add SMP-specifc SMP_FATAL_MULTITASKING_START_ON_NOT_ONLINE_PROCESSOR fatal error. This fatal error helps to diagnose a broken SMP startup sequence. Without this error a context switch using the NULL pointer for the thread control block happens which may be difficult to debug.
